首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在数据库中直接为用户设置密码?

在数据库中直接为用户设置密码可以通过以下步骤实现:

  1. 创建用户:首先,在数据库中创建一个新用户,可以使用数据库管理工具或者执行相应的 SQL 命令来创建用户。例如,在 MySQL 数据库中,可以使用以下命令创建用户:
  2. 创建用户:首先,在数据库中创建一个新用户,可以使用数据库管理工具或者执行相应的 SQL 命令来创建用户。例如,在 MySQL 数据库中,可以使用以下命令创建用户:
  3. 这将创建一个名为 'username' 的用户,并设置密码为 'password'。
  4. 授予权限:接下来,为用户授予适当的权限,以便其可以访问和操作数据库中的数据。可以使用 GRANT 命令来授予权限。例如,在 MySQL 数据库中,可以使用以下命令授予用户对特定数据库的全部权限:
  5. 授予权限:接下来,为用户授予适当的权限,以便其可以访问和操作数据库中的数据。可以使用 GRANT 命令来授予权限。例如,在 MySQL 数据库中,可以使用以下命令授予用户对特定数据库的全部权限:
  6. 这将授予用户 'username' 对数据库 'database_name' 的全部权限。
  7. 刷新权限:在完成用户创建和权限授予后,需要刷新数据库的权限信息,以使新的用户和权限生效。可以使用 FLUSH PRIVILEGES 命令来刷新权限。例如,在 MySQL 数据库中,可以使用以下命令刷新权限:
  8. 刷新权限:在完成用户创建和权限授予后,需要刷新数据库的权限信息,以使新的用户和权限生效。可以使用 FLUSH PRIVILEGES 命令来刷新权限。例如,在 MySQL 数据库中,可以使用以下命令刷新权限:

通过以上步骤,就可以在数据库中直接为用户设置密码,并为其授予适当的权限。这样,用户就可以使用指定的用户名和密码来访问和操作数据库了。

腾讯云提供了多种数据库产品,可以根据具体需求选择适合的产品。例如,腾讯云的云数据库 MySQL(TencentDB for MySQL)是一种高性能、可扩展的关系型数据库服务,支持数据备份、容灾、自动扩缩容等功能。您可以通过以下链接了解更多关于腾讯云云数据库 MySQL 的信息:腾讯云云数据库 MySQL

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

mysql修改root用户密码语法_设置mysql的root密码

-p password "newpwd" 语法参数说明如下: usermame 指需要修改密码用户名称,在这里指定为 root 用户; hostname 指需要修改密码用户主机名,该参数可以不写,...默认是 localhost; password 关键字,而不是指旧密码; newpwd 设置密码,必须用双引号括起来。...参考资料: 忘记密码 忘记密码的情况下如何强制修改密码,我在此提供一种办法。 1. 以超级管理员打开cmd,关闭mysql服务 net stop mysql 2....新的窗口中登录mysql 使用命令: mysql -u root -p 无需输入密码直接回车即可。 4. 切换到mysql,将密码置空。...设置加密规则并更新新密码,授权(直接复制这些SQL语句你的密码会更新123456) ALTER USER 'root'@'localhost' IDENTIFIED BY '123456' PASSWORD

9.5K40
  • 如何查找Linux系统密码空的所有用户

    如何查找Linux系统密码空的所有用户如何查找Linux系统密码空的所有用户进入主题之前,让我们快速回顾一下Shadow文件及其用途。...:' | cut -d: -f1图片如何查找Linux系统密码空的所有用户如何查找Linux系统密码空的所有用户查看特定账户的密码状态上述命令将列出所有没有密码的帐户。...NP - 该帐户没有密码。PS – 该帐户有一个可用的密码。注意:基于 Debian 的系统密码状态将分别用L、N、P来标识。Linux设置账户密码您可以作为无密码用户登录,但并不推荐!..., SHA512 crypt.)如何查找Linux系统密码空的所有用户如何查找Linux系统密码空的所有用户图片在Linux锁定账户有时,您想要锁定一个没有密码的账户。...最后,我们学习了如何用户设置密码,以及如何在 Linux 锁定和解锁用户

    6.2K30

    Ubuntu 如何设置和管理 root 用户权限?

    本文将详细介绍 Ubuntu 如何设置和管理 root 用户权限,并讨论一些常见的安全风险和预防措施。什么是 root 用户?root 用户是指 Linux 系统具有最高权限的用户。...如何启用 root 用户 Ubuntu ,默认情况下是禁用 root 用户的。但是,我们可以通过以下两种方式启用 root 用户:1....启用 root 用户如果需要直接使用 root 用户登录系统,可以通过以下命令启用 root 用户:$ sudo passwd root然后输入当前用户密码,并设置 root 用户密码。...设置成功后,就可以以 root 用户身份登录系统了。如何禁用 root 用户?...为了提高系统的安全性,日常运维,我们不应该直接使用 root 用户登录系统,而是应该使用 sudo 命令来执行管理员操作。

    7.5K00

    数据库如何安全储存用户的重要信息密码

    数据库如何安全储存用户的重要信息/密码? 怎么样才能安全,有效地储存这些私密信息呢,即使数据库泄露了,别人也无法通过查看数据库的数据,直接获取用户设定的密码。这样可以大大提高保密程度。...运行后显示结果: 我们可以看到,不加密,储存进数据库后,密码一眼就可以看穿,万一数据库被入侵,用户的账户财产,隐私等都会受到威胁!...但是,单纯地只对用户设置密码进行md5加密,是不足以保密用户隐私的。 如果用户使用弱口令密码,那么其密码加密后的md5值,也是不安全的。...加密算法再次升级 为了使用户可能输入的密码弱口令,我们可以在用户设置密码前面加上一串比较复杂的密钥,这样可以增加密码md5加密前的复杂性。...验证密码环节 验证用户密码的时候,我们只需要再次将该加密过程执行一遍,然后将得出的md5加密后的结果与我们数据库的MD5结果对比,即可验证用户是否输入正确的密码

    1.4K40

    什么叫给密码“加盐”?如何安全的你的用户密码“加盐”?

    什么叫给密码“加盐”?如何安全的你的用户密码“加盐”?...用户ID:1 // 查询数据库的数据 $sth = $pdo->prepare("SELECT * FROM zyblog_test_user"); $sth->execute(); $result...代码还是比较简单的,注册的时候,我们直接用户密码进行加密后入库。主要关注的地方是登录时,我们先根据用户名查找出对应的用户信息。...然后将用户登录提交上来的原文密码进行加密,与数据库的原文密码进行对比验证,密码验证成功即可判断用户登录成功。 另外还需要注意的是,我们的盐字符串也是要存到数据库的。...因为大家都喜欢用同一个用户名和密码注册不同的网站,所以不管其他怎么加盐都是没用的,毕竟原文密码是对的,拿到这样一个网站的数据库用户明文密码后,就可以通过这些密码去尝试这些用户在其他网站是不是用了相同的帐号名和密码注册了帐号

    8.3K32

    C#的WinForm窗体程序如何设置TextBox密码文本框

    C#的WinForm窗体程序如何设置TextBox密码文本框 – 2019-08-03 23:59 C#的WinForm窗体程序开发过程,TextBox是常用的文本框控件,默认的TextBox...文本 框输入的内容是可见的,如果在Winform程序设置TextBox文本框密码输入框应该如何设置呢?...其实将TextBox文本框设置密码输入 框,也非常的简单,只需要设置TextBox文本框属性的PasswordChar属性值,PasswordChar属性值自定义,可以为*号,代表输 入字符显示星号...Winform窗体程序设计界面选中TextBox文本框,然后右键菜单中有个属性,打开属性界面后,属性设置栏中找到PasswordChar,将PasswordChar属性值设置成某一个常量,如星号*,...如设置PasswordChar属性值@后,则Winform窗体运行后输入密码效果如下: 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/154843.html原文链接

    5.3K20

    如何在Debian 9上用户目录设置vsftpd

    准备 要学习本教程,您需要: Debian 9服务器和具有sudo权限的非root用户。您可以使用Debian 9进行初始服务器设置中了解有关如何使用这些权限创建用户的更多信息。...userlist_deny=NO userlist_deny切换逻辑:当设置YES时,列表用户被拒绝FTP访问。...设置NO时,只允许列表用户访问。 完成更改后,保存文件并退出编辑器。 最后,让我们将用户添加到/etc/vsftpd.userlist。...“ 加密”下拉菜单下,选择“ 要求显式FTP over TLS”。 对于登录类型,选择询问密码用户”字段填写您的FTP用户: 点击连接在界面的底部。...这确认用户不能再ssh访问服务器,仅限于FTP访问。 结论 本教程,我们介绍了具有本地帐户的用户设置FTP。如果您需要使用外部身份验证源,您可能希望了解vsftpd对虚拟用户的支持。

    2.9K40

    如何在Ubuntu 16.04上用户目录设置vsftpd

    本教程,我们将向您展示如何配置vsftpd以允许用户使用具有SSL / TLS保护的登录凭据的FTP将文件上载到他或她的主目录。...即便如此,我们建议您在配置和测试设置之前先与新用户联系。 首先,我们将添加一个测试用户: sudo adduser sammy 提示时分配密码,可以通过其他提示按“ENTER”。...当它设置“YES”时,列表用户被拒绝FTP访问。当它设置“NO”时,只允许列表用户访问。完成更改后,保存并退出文件。 最后,我们将创建用户并将其添加到文件。...“加密”下拉菜单下,选择“要求显式FTP over TLS”。 对于“登录类型”,选择“询问密码”。用户”字段填写您创建的FTP用户: 单击界面底部的“连接”。...这确认用户不能再用ssh来访问服务器,仅限于FTP访问。 结论 本教程,我们介绍了具有本地帐户的用户设置FTP。如果您需要使用外部身份验证源,您可能需要了解vsftpd对虚拟用户的支持。

    2.3K00

    如何在Ubuntu 18.04上用户目录设置vsftpd

    =/etc/vsftpd.userlist userlist_deny=NO userlist_deny切换逻辑:当设置YES时,列表用户被拒绝FTP访问。...设置NO时,只允许列表用户访问。 完成更改后,保存文件并退出编辑器。 最后,让我们将用户添加到/etc/vsftpd.userlist。...第七步 - 使用FileZilla测试TLS 大多数现代FTP客户端都可以配置使用TLS加密。我们将演示如何与FileZilla连接,因为它支持跨平台。...“User”字段填写您的FTP用户: [site-config2.png] 点击Connect界面的底部。系统将要求您输入用户密码: [user-pass.png] 单击OK以进行连接。...这确认用户不能再使用ssh访问服务器,其仅限于FTP访问。 结论 本教程,我们介绍了具有本地帐户的用户设置FTP。如果您需要使用外部身份验证源,您可能需要了解vsftpd对虚拟用户的支持。

    2.7K00

    MySQL数据库远程连接、创建新用户设置权限、更改用户密码

    上篇文章我们写了服务器上安装MySQL,可以随时远程连接,我们这次讲如何创建一个新的用户,给予权限,并且实现远程连接! 1、新建用户 创建ssh用户密码是ssh。...更改用户密码: 方法1: 用SET PASSWORD命令 首先登录MySQL。...a.授权格式:grant 权限 on 数据库.* to 用户名@登录主机 identified by '密码';  b.登录MYSQL,这里以ROOT身份登录: mysql -u root -p c....用户创建一个数据库(test ): create database test DEFAULT CHARSET utf8 COLLATE utf8_general_ci; 创建后用show databases...因为是直接使用 SQL 语句的方式来删除账户,所以必须先选择 mysql 自身的数据库: use mysql; 好了,现在用ssh账户登陆,开始建表!

    8.2K21

    如何在 Linux 设置 SSH 无密码登录?

    Linux 系统,使用 SSH 可以方便地远程连接到其他计算机,并且还可以通过配置无密码登录来提高操作的便利性和安全性。本文将介绍如何在 Linux 设置 SSH 无密码登录。图片1....终端执行以下命令来生成 SSH 密钥对:ssh-keygen -t rsa生成命令会要求你输入密钥文件的保存路径和文件名,以及一个可选的密码(用于保护私钥)。...终端执行以下命令来复制公钥到远程主机(假设远程主机的 IP 地址 remote_host,用户名为 username):ssh-copy-id username@remote_host执行该命令后...终端执行以下命令来测试无密码登录(假设远程主机的 IP 地址 remote_host,用户名为 username):ssh username@remote_host如果一切顺利,你将能够无需输入密码即可成功登录到远程主机...本文介绍了 Linux 设置 SSH 无密码登录的步骤,包括生成密钥对、复制公钥到远程主机以及配置 SSH 连接。通过正确设置和使用 SSH,你可以更加安全地管理远程主机,并提高工作效率。

    3.5K10

    如何在 Linux 设置 SSH 无密码登录

    本文[1],我们将向您展示如何在基于 RHEL 的 Linux 发行版(例如 CentOS、Fedora、Rocky Linux 和 AlmaLinux)以及基于 Debian 的发行版(例如 Ubuntu...本例,我们将设置 SSH 无密码自动登录,从服务器 192.168.0.12 以用户 howtoing 登录到 192.168.0.11 以用户 sheena 登录。 1....禁用密码验证(可选) 为了提高安全性,您可以远程服务器上禁用密码身份验证,仅允许 SSH 密钥身份验证。...$ sudo nano /etc/ssh/sshd_config OR $ sudo vi /etc/ssh/sshd_config 找到包含PasswordAuthentication 的行并将其设置...$ ssh sheena@192.168.0.11 本文中,您学习了如何使用 ssh 密钥设置 SSH 无密码登录。我希望这个过程很简单。如果您有任何疑问,请在下面的评论部分发表。

    64020

    Linux 非 SSH 用户配置 SFTP 环境

    某些环境,系统管理员想要允许极少数用户可以传输文件到Linux机器,但是不允许使用 SSH。要实现这一目的,我们可以使用SFTP,并为其构建chroot环境。...当我们SFTP配置chroot环境后,只有被许可的用户可以访问,并被限制到他们的家目录,换言之:被许可的用户将处于牢笼环境,在此环境它们甚至不能切换它们的目录。...本文中,我们将配置RHEL 6.X 和 CentOS 6.X的SFTP Chroot环境。我们开启一个用户帐号‘Jack’,该用户将被允许Linux机器上传输文件,但没有ssh访问权限。...步骤:1 创建组 [root@localhost ~]# groupadd sftp_users 步骤:2 分配附属组(sftp_users)给用户 如果用户系统上不存在,使用以下命令创建( LCTT...-s /sbin/nologin jack 注意:如果你想要修改用户的默认家目录,那么可以useradd和usermod命令中使用‘-d’选项,并设置合适的权限。

    4.7K30
    领券